Misconceptions Concerning Roof Covering Materials
When it comes to roofing products, you have actually likely experienced several mistaken beliefs that can bring about poor selections. One typical myth is that all roofing materials are equally durable. In truth, different materials have varying life-spans and resistance to weather conditions. For example, asphalt shingles might be affordable, but they generally call for more regular substitutes contrasted to metal or ceramic tile roof coverings.
One more misconception is that lighter-colored roof products are always better for energy performance. While lighter hues reflect sunshine, elements like insulation and ventilation likewise play crucial roles in preserving power efficiency.
You may additionally assume that a greater rate assurances better high quality. However, some costly materials may not be suitable for your particular climate or roofing framework. It's necessary to assess the efficiency features as opposed to just the price.
Lastly, numerous think that all roof materials are ecologically unsafe. Actually, alternatives like metal and certain types of tiles can be recycled, offering a greener alternative.
Maintenance Misconceptions to Stay Clear Of
Many homeowners ignore the value of regular roof upkeep, leading to a host of misconceptions that can jeopardize the honesty of their roofs. One typical misconception is that a roof only needs upkeep when there's visible damages. In reality, proactive evaluations can catch concerns prior to they escalate, saving you money and time over time.
One more misunderstanding is that cleaning your roofing is unnecessary. In time, particles and algae can build up, advertising degeneration and reducing your roofing system's life-span. Routine cleansing is vital to preserve its problem.
You might also think that DIY upkeep is sufficient. While some tasks are convenient, expert inspections and repairs can ensure security and effectiveness.
Several homeowners assume that once they've installed a new roofing, maintenance is no longer needed. Even new roofings require routine upkeep to ensure they perform as intended.
Last but not least, there's a belief that all roof covering materials require the very same upkeep. Different materials have special requirements, and comprehending those can protect against premature wear.
Life-span and Replacement Misconceptions
Despite what you could hear, the life-span of your roof frequently differs dramatically based on the materials utilized and local environment problems. Numerous homeowners think that all roof coverings last the exact same quantity of time, however that's far from the truth.
For instance, asphalt roof shingles commonly last 15 to thirty years, while steel roofings can last 40 to 70 years. If visit the following website reside in an area with severe climate, your roof covering might require substitute faster than anticipated.
An additional common myth is that you need to replace your roof covering every 20 years, regardless of its problem. Normal inspections can aid you determine possible concerns early, and several roofing systems can last much longer if properly preserved.
Moreover, some home owners think they can simply include a brand-new layer of tiles over their old roof, yet this can lead to difficulties, consisting of caught wetness and insufficient air flow.
Eventually, staying informed concerning your particular roof material and its needs is important. Do not rely on misconceptions; speak with an expert to figure out the real life-span and necessary maintenance for your roofing system.
Taking aggressive steps can conserve you money and extend the life of your roof covering significantly.
